Downspout Blockage Removal in Pittsburgh, PA
Downspout blockage removal services focus on clearing obstructions that prevent rainwater from flowing properly through the downspouts connected to a property’s gutter system. These services typically address issues caused by debris such as leaves, twigs, dirt, and sometimes small nests that can accumulate and cause clogs. Projects may involve inspecting the entire gutter and downspout system, removing blockages manually or with specialized tools, and ensuring that water can drain freely away from the foundation to prevent water damage or basement flooding.
Homeowners interested in this service often want to understand the signs of a blockage, such as overflowing gutters, water pooling around the foundation, or visible debris in the downspouts. Before requesting downspout blockage removal, property owners should consider the extent of the clog, the accessibility of the downspouts, and whether any additional repairs or upgrades, like installing screens or extending downspouts, might be beneficial for long-term drainage management. Proper maintenance can help protect the property from water-related issues and maintain the integrity of the gutter system.

Downspout Blockage Removal Questions
What causes downspout blockages? Common causes include leaves, twigs, dirt, and debris that accumulate over time, obstructing water flow.
How can I tell if my downspouts are blocked? Signs include overflowing gutters, water pooling around the foundation, or visible debris at the outlet.
Is blockage removal safe for my property? Yes, professional removal ensures that downspouts are cleared without causing damage to the system or surrounding areas.
How often should downspouts be checked for blockages? Regular inspections, especially after storms or during fall, help prevent buildup and water issues.
